Brandy And Monique‘s The Boy Is Mine tour hit a snag Saturday night when Brandy abruptly left the stage in the middle of the performance, leaving Monica to close the show solo.
The R&B legends were performing at Chicago’s United Center when Brandy appeared frustrated by sound issues and stopped mid-song.

“Give me a second, I need to get my…” she told the crowd before walking backstage.
But Brandy never returned and after several minutes of confusion, Monica continued alone and ended the evening without performing their 1998 duet, “The Boy Is Mine.”
Fans flooded social media with clips and questions, wondering why the series ended early. Saturday’s hiccups come just months after the couple announced their reunion tour marking more than two decades since their hit single made music history and years after their highly publicized feud.
No official word yet from either artist on what caused Brandy’s early departure. We’ve reached out to Brandy and Monica’s reps…so far, no response.
